Overview of 03 7076 1360

The phone number 03 7076 1360 has been flagged by numerous users as a scam related to PayPal impersonation. Scammers operating with this number are reported to pose as representatives from PayPal, contacting individuals under the threat of fraudulent activities on non-existent accounts. Users have reported aggressive tactics designed to extort personal information, such as email addresses and codes sent via text.

User Experiences

Multiple reports reveal a pattern of calls where the individual claiming to be "Richard" asserts that the recipient's PayPal account has been compromised due to fraudulent Bitcoin transactions. With demands for personal information, particularly email addresses, and the implication of urgency, these callers employ high-pressure techniques to manipulate potential victims.

Classification of 03 7076 1360

Based on the reviews collected, 03 7076 1360 can be classified as a scam phone number. The characteristics noted include:

  • Claims of fraudulent transactions on non-existent accounts.
  • Persistent demands for email addresses and sensitive information.
  • Consistent use of aggressive language and intimidation tactics.
  • A backdrop of noise indicative of a call centre, suggesting a mass operation.

Recommended Action

If you receive a call from this number, it is advisable to hang up immediately and block the number to prevent future calls. Never disclose any personal information or engage with the caller, as they are trained to torment and pressure individuals into compliance. Reporting the number to local authorities, and documenting your experiences on platforms like Reverse AU can also help safeguard others from falling victim.

    Cromwell


    Some heavy accented guy called Richard claimed I had fraudulent charges on my pay pal account. Apparently someone in Texas had attempted to purchase some bitcoins. Richard asked me if I had given my password to anyone. I said no. He said he needed my email address and password so he could put a hold on my account.

    Told him no way. He then said he was sending me a text message and I had to read out the code. Again told him no. He then started screaming at the top of his voice at me saying “you are a stupid f*king bitch, I will get you”

    I hung up and blocked the number.

    Freiberger


    Caller identified himself as Richard from PayPal and was advising me that my account had been compromised and they had discovered a fraudulent charge for $349.99 for Bitcoin.

    (I don’t have a PayPal account)

    He said to quickly remove this charge, I needed to read him an email they had sent me. But before I was to read the email, he needed my email address. I said “I thought you said you had just sent me an email” he said “take this seriously and tell me your email address linked to your PayPal account”

    I made up a fake email address as janet.jackson@hotmail (a Janet Jackson song was on my tv at the time:-D)

    He then said it wasn’t corresponding to the email address they had on file. I then said “well why are you asking me for my email if it doesn’t correspond? My name is Janet Jackson and it’s the only email I have.

    At this point I could hear a lot of call centre noise in the background and they were all yelling obscenities.

    He then said “I’ve sent you a 6 digit code to your phone via text, can you read it out?”

    No message came through, but I made up a fake 6 digit code.

    He told me it was incorrect and I had to give him the code. I repeated the fake number. He then started yelling at me to give him the real code.

    I then remembered I had a whistle near by and blew it really loud into the phone.

    He then got extremely aggressive and yelled “give me your code now you f*king bitch”

    I blew the whistle again, hung up on him & blocked the number.
